What is the Italian phrase 'scarpe fighe' in English?

"Hot shoes" is an English equivalent of the Italian phrase "scarpe fighe."

Specifically, the feminine noun "scarpe" means "shoes." The feminine adjective "fighe" means "hot, sexy." The pronunciation is "SKAHR-peh FEE-gheh."
